Listed Nigerian plantation giants, Presco and Okomu, have been propelled by favourable global winds and local expansion to ride a wave of earnings surge. The two leading palm oil producers defied volatile commodity markets and domestic economic pressures in 2025 to post revenues approximating ₦529 billion, up over 60 per cent year-on-year, and almost double net profits to around ₦202 billion versus the 2024. Their performance depicts the sector’s capacity to withstand shocks.
